The latest yt-dlp patch in Fedora addresses CVE-2023-35934, reinforcing security for video downloading activities.
Update to 2023.07.06

Summary

yt-dlp is a command-line program to download videos from many different online

video platforms, such as youtube.com. The project is a fork of youtube-dl with

additional features and fixes.

Update to 2023.07.06. Mitigates CVE-2023-35934 / GHSA-v8mc-9377-rwjj

* Fri Jul 7 2023 Maxwell G - 2023.07.06-1

- Update to 2023.07.06.

- Mitigates CVE-2023-35934 / GHSA-v8mc-9377-rwjj
